Located at 4500 W Amazon Dr, in Eugene, Oregon, Ridgeline Montessori is a cozy K-5 school that hosts 244 students (grades K through 8), overseen by Eugene SD 4J. Enrollment runs roughly 24% smaller than the state mean of about 321.
Ridgeline Montessori is one of 36 schools operated by Eugene SD 4J, a district that enrolls 15,712 students overall.
Looking at the student body, Ridgeline Montessori lists that the largest single group is White, at 75% of enrollment; the rest reads as 12% Hispanic, 10% multiracial.
In terms of school funding signals, Ridgeline Montessori shows 11 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 22.2:1. The state averages around 16.5:1, so this campus is higher than the state norm typical. Around 64% of the student body qualifies for free or reduced-price meals, which schools and policymakers use as a rough income-mix signal. Set against Lane County (around 76%), the school's rate is south of typical.
On a residual basis (actual vs predicted given the student mix), Ridgeline Montessori is in the OUTPERFORMING tier of the BeatsExpectations model, which fits a per-state line through proficiency and FRL share. Schools with this campus's poverty mix typically land near 37.9%; this one delivers 65.3%, a residual of +27.3 points.
In the surrounding community, Lane County reports that median household earnings sit near $71,544, 34%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the poverty rate sits near 8%. In all, Lane County runs 117 public schools (combined enrollment of about 42,240 students), of which Ridgeline Montessori is one.
Nearest neighbor: Edgewood Community Elementary School, around 0.4 miles off.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ools. Among the 7 schools in that immediate cluster with test data (this one included), Ridgeline Montessori ranks 3rd on composite proficiency, higher than the local average of 53.6%.
Ridgeline Montessori operates from a city-core location. Ridgeline Montessori operates as a public charter school, meaning it is publicly funded but governed independently of the surrounding district's traditional schools.
Trend over the last 7 years. Looking back 7 years, enrollment at Ridgeline Montessori has showed little movement, going from 247 students in 2018 to 244 in 2025. Hispanic enrollment moved from 7% to 12% across the same window. The student-to-teacher ratio fell from 25.9:1 in 2018 to 22.2:1 today.
